Hot Seat
with
Mika Salo - Tyrrell.
F1 Racing,
September 1997.
Q:
What was your first car?
A: A Mini 850 - a piece of junk I rebuilt. But my friend
crashed it before I got my driving licence.
Q:
What car do you own now?
A: I have lots of different cars, including a Ferrari
F355.
Q:
What's the fastest you've ever driven on the road?
A: 321 km/h on a German autobahn.
Q:
